icbrkr wrote:I'm using a DVI -> HDMI adapter from the Amiga to the monitor. And now that I said that, maybe that's the issue?
Does the DVI plug support full DVI Dual Layer (DVI DL)? I.e. does it have all the pins in one rectangular block or is there a sort of gap in the middle, creating two squarish blocks of pins? If the latter, you need a better adapter with the full DVI DL.
